Though known bY the epithet el ,Lamh Lauaier, his Cluistiusi name was J. hn; but in these times lath Ittnilies of the same name were distinguish ed from , each other by some term lattiat+ five of their natural disposition, physical p nver, camplexion, or figure. _ thieetile instance; was called Parra • Chas:l4l4*a swift Paddy, from his fleetness effect. ..44.. another Shoup bu:e, or yellow Jack; from his billious look; a third, Mice& AIIA,-Of' big M ichael, from his uncommon size; etni - a fourth Sheeinus Rook or red Jamese t from the color of his hair. These epithelia to be sure, will still occur in Ireland, bus far less frequently now than in the thee* of which we write, when Irish was thesis,* nacular language of the day. It wasfai a reason similar to those just alleged del* John O'ROl lie was known as Lamb 4 ale! . her O'Roi lies he, as well as his forefather. fur two or three generations, having been remarkable for prodigious bodily streagthr - and cou I age The evening wallies adltalyl4 ced as O'Rurke bent his steps to the atil chard.
